How can researchers effectively leverage the strengths of qualitative and quantitative data to uncover novel insights and push the boundaries of knowledge in their respective fields?

Researchers can effectively leverage the strengths of qualitative and quantitative data by integrating both types of data in their research design. Qualitative data can provide depth and context to quantitative findings, while quantitative data can provide statistical rigor and generalizability to qualitative findings. By triangulating data from different sources, researchers can gain a more comprehensive understanding of their research topic and uncover novel insights. This integration allows researchers to push the boundaries of knowledge in their respective fields by offering a more nuanced and holistic perspective on complex research questions.
